Steel Battalion, Is It Worth It?
Let us know what you thought about this episode!
Boasting a controller with over 40 buttons across 3 different panels, two joysticks, 3 foot pedals, a near 40 page operations manual, and the biggest box you've ever seen, we finally get together to play the original Xbox "holy grail" STEEL BATTALION. Is it just a pricey gimmick, or a tried and true mech suit simulation experience? Is it worth the price?
